Output aa105cfac86e9e93e8f749b6083253d8a40360b97decf8d8b760a767cdccc59f:6

value
2333260
script pubkey
OP_0 OP_PUSHBYTES_20 ba37807118cd0023cc10ad77f1ea2b46e16e42d2
address
bc1qhgmcqugce5qz8nqs44mlr63tgmskuskjrtkstv
transaction
aa105cfac86e9e93e8f749b6083253d8a40360b97decf8d8b760a767cdccc59f
confirmations
167822
spent
true